Docket No. 07070024 Z: SW Old Town C-2 Rezoning The applicant seeks approval to rezone 57 parcels frori. R-2/Residence, B-l/Business, B- 2lBusiness, B-3/Business and 1-I/IndustriaJ to C-2/01d Town. The sites are located in Old Town and along Third A venue SW. Filed by the Department of Community Services The City of Carmel is petitioning to rezone several parcels in Old Town and along Third Avenue SW to the C-2/0Id Town District, as established in Chapter 20P of the Carmel Zoning Ordinance. Cun'entJy, the subject properties are zoned R-2/Residence, H-lIBusilless, B-2/Business, B-3/Busilless and 1- If Industrial. In requesting this rezoning, the City is considering the following: Land Use. Allows residential and business to co-exist in a mixed use environment. The current zoning would not allow residential uses in many of these areas. Approval Process. So that review efforts are not duplicated between the Plan Commission and Carmel Redevelopment Commission, the C-2/0Id Town District establishes the Carmel Redevelopment Commission as the lead the review and approval body. The CRC npproval is then subject to Plan Commission approval at a hearing facilitated by the PC Hearing Officcr. Request. Only the City of Carmel can petition for a C-2/0Id Town Rezoning, not a property owner. A majority of the area is either owned by the City of Carmel, Carmel Redevelopment Commission or busincss landowners whom have requested this designation. Aerial Map At thc Sept 4 Subdivision committee meeting, The Committee voted to send a favorable recommendation tot the Full Plan Commission with the following conditions: A.) 3 parcels were removed from the list of affected parcels to be rezoned, and B.) that sections for privacy and sun rights will be prepared for each project/site, The Department of Community Services recommends the Plan Commission forward this item the City Council with a positive recommendation.
